Solar PV Analysis of Nablus, Palestine

Nablus, Palestine is a relatively good location for generating energy through solar panels all year round. The amount of electricity that can be produced varies from season to season due to changes in sunlight availability. During summer, you can expect the highest electricity production with around 8.60 kWh per day for each kW of installed solar panels.

Renewable energy potential in the State of Palestine: Proposals

With 3,400 hours of sunlight per year and an average daily global solar radiation ranging from 6.15 to 8.27 kWh/m 2, Palestine has a great potential for solar energy [7], [8]. An overview of renewable energy strategies and policies in Palestine

Palestine has one of the highest solar irradiation in the region with an average daily solar irradiation of 5.4–6 kWh/m 2 /day and more than 3000 h of sunshine per year (Çamur & Abdallah, 2021; Ismail et al., 2013a). Solar PV Analysis of Rafah, Palestine

Rafah, Palestine is a fairly good location for generating solar energy throughout the year. The amount of electricity produced varies with the seasons, but it''s still quite significant. In simple terms, for every kilowatt (kW) of solar panels installed at this location, you can expect to generate about 8.29 kilowatt-hours (kWh) of electricity per day in summer, 5.21 kWh/day in autumn,

Solar PV Analysis of Bethlehem, Palestine

Bethlehem, Palestine is a pretty good location for generating solar energy throughout the year. The amount of electricity you can produce with a solar panel depends on the time of year. During summer, you can expect to generate about 8.77 units of electricity per day for every unit of your solar panel''s capacity (kWh/day per kW).

Solar PV Analysis of Tulkarm, Palestine

To maximize your solar PV system''s energy output in Tulkarm, Palestine (Lat/Long 32.3107, 35.0217) throughout the year, you should tilt your panels at an angle of 27° South for fixed panel installations.
